Summary

The brief ABC News segment shows surveillance video of a partial roof collapse at a BJ's Wholesale Club store in Ocean Township, New Jersey, during heavy rain. It states that 27 people were inside, two were partially trapped but freed themselves, and no injuries occurred. The incident happened on the morning of July 6, 2026, on Route 35 amid severe storms and flooding. Reports cite the Monmouth County Sheriff’s Office and local police as sources confirming the details and safe evacuation.

Editorial Assessment

The broadcast presents a concise, accurate account fully corroborated by contemporaneous reporting from ABC7NY, FOX5NY, News12 New Jersey, NBC News, and official statements. No unsupported claims, loaded language, or omissions of material context. Viewer receives the essential verified facts without exaggeration or speculation. Minor differences across sources in exact clock time (around 11 a.m.) are negligible and do not undermine reliability.
